Frank Fritz is an American television personality, collector, and antique dealer. He is best known for his role as one of the hosts of the History Channel's reality television series American Pickers.
Fritz was born on October 11, 1965, in Davenport, Iowa. He grew up in the nearby town of Bettendorf, Iowa. Fritz attended Bettendorf High School, where he played football and baseball. After graduating from high school, Fritz worked as a security guard and a bouncer. In the early 1990s, Fritz began collecting antiques and vintage items. He soon opened his own antique store, Frank Fritz Finds, in Savanna, Illinois.
In 2010, Fritz was approached by the History Channel to be one of the hosts of American Pickers. The show follows Fritz and his co-host, Mike Wolfe, as they travel across the United States in search of hidden treasures. American Pickers has become one of the most popular shows on the History Channel, and Fritz has become a household name.
In July 2022, it was announced that Fritz had suffered a stroke. He was hospitalized for several weeks and underwent rehabilitation. Fritz has since returned home, but he is still recovering from the stroke. It is unclear if he will be able to return to American Pickers.
